You Riding Your ATV Over Gold?
One of the most famous prospectors of the time, trapper/gold seeker “Pegleg
Smith” traveled through the Anza Borrego region. It's rumored he discovered
black gold somewhere in the east part of the Park. Where he found his gold has
never been discovered, or if it has, the location has never been published or
verified.
Oatman & the Wild Burros
Oatman is a fun place to visit -- an authentic old western town with burros roaming the streets and gunfights staged on weekends. The burros are tame and can be hand fed. Enjoy an exploration!
